Side-by-Side Comparison
| Feature | gaita | gaviota |
|---|---|---|
| Definition | Instrumento musical de viento que consiste en un tubo preformado (puntero), provisto de caña e insertado dentro de un odre, que es la reserva de aire. | Nombre común de la mayoría de las especies de aves de la familia Laridae. Son aves de ambientes acuáticos, que se reúnen en colonias y son principalmente depredadoras o carroñeras, pero también pueden consumir alimentos de origen vegetal. Su plumaje de adulto suele contener los colores blanco, gris y negro, mientras que el pico y las patas pueden ser amarillos, rojos o de tonnos intermedios entre ambos. |
